How Hydro Jetting Works?
High pressure water jetting uses special hoses and nozzles to send high-pressure water through your sewer and drain pipes. As the nozzle moves, water breaks up grease, sludge, and debris, washing it all away. The spray cleans the entire inside of the pipe, not just a small part.

Why Hydro Jetting Is Different From Traditional Drain Clearing
Traditional drain snaking can work for simple clogs, but it often leaves residue stuck to the inside of the pipe.

That’s why many drains start clogging up again just weeks or months later. Hydro jetting thoroughly cleans the entire pipe wall, restoring full flow instead of simply poking a hole through the blockage.
For homes and businesses experiencing recurring sewer issues, this deeper-cleaning approach often delivers far better long-term drain performance.

Hydro jetting is often highly effective for clearing smaller root masses and removing the sludge and buildup surrounding them. By thoroughly cleaning the pipe walls, sewer jetting helps restore flow and allows plumbers to evaluate the line’s true condition afterward.

Sewer Camera Inspections & Hydro Jetting
Before jetting begins, our team may perform a sewer camera inspection to evaluate the condition of the line.

Camera inspections help ensure high-pressure water jetting jetting is both safe and effective for the specific condition of the sewer system. After cleaning, the line may also be reinspected to verify that buildup has been fully removed and to identify whether any deeper sewer repair issues remain.
